Facts to Contemplate in Determining Whether to Move to an Old House or a New Home

Do you intend to move from your existing residential home?  Are you uncertain whether to procure an old house or a newly constructed one?  There tend to be pros and negatives to each of those possible choices.  Right here are several essentials to be aware of.

More recent homes provide larger kitchens and bigger bathrooms.  Older models in many cases come with tiny cubicles for kitchens and quite often tinier areas for bathrooms.  It seems like it was the 1960′s when newly designed residences were crafted with larger kitchens, and in today’s times this is what a good number of folks are used to.  Bathrooms can typically be a concern.  In former times a bathroom was basically known as a functional place where families washed up.  In recent decades many women regard a bathroom as an area to relax with a luxury bath or to indulge in some pampering after a difficult day.  The market abounds exponentially with products like bath salts and bath oils and creams.  The tiny sized bathrooms of older residences do not lend themselves well to the idea of this room as a relaxing getaway.

Not only do the older homes possess compact kitchens and bathrooms, but generally smaller bedrooms and living rooms too.  People used to contemporary larger living spaces may feel slightly claustrophobic.  A common trend nowadays is to have an open floor plan where the kitchen, living room and dining room are all in the same space undivided by partitions..  In the majority of older homes these rooms are all separate areas.

A different pitfall of older residences is the possibility for encountering extensive repair costs.  Anyone deliberating choosing this sort of house need to have such things as the electrical wiring and plumbing evaluated thoroughly.  Make it a point and ask how old the roof is.  One doesn’t wish to move into a home and end up being unpleasantly shocked with substantial repair bills.

On the other hand there are pros to having a home which was built between approximately 1900-1960.  Most of these residences tend to far exceed their newer counterparts in charm, warmth and a splendid sense of romance.  When you walk into an older house and see glowing wood flooring, enchanting nooks and crannies, and decorative work such as gingerbread on the exterior, you are able to well recognise their own appeal.  Additionally they emanate a sense of history and character that can be in most cases missing in new residences.

Moreover, the older residences are more often than not found on tree lined streets.  Having trees that are centuries old in your property and neighborhood, contributes significantly to a warm homey ambiance.  It does not matter how extensive or expensive the landscaping is in the newer homes and subdivisions, if the old trees happen to be cut down, there is a decided lack of warmth within the neighborhood.

In summary, the older residences might be preferable for people such as this author who’re incurably romantic, provided that they have it checked out by an expert ahead of time to ward off future repair expenditures.  Those of a slightly more practical nature could very well be happier in a newer residence.
